"A party of eight of us stayed here for four nights and we were very pleased with the hotel. The breakfasts were very good and the evening meal we had one time was excellent. The biggest problem was the distance to the city centre, quite a long way and Porto is very hilly. The buses, however, stopped right outside the hotel and cost one euro forty-five cents to the centre. Taxis arrived within minuets and cost six euros. On the whole very difficult to fault this hotel. " - Eric Hook
